Vellum
The Precision ODM for Asynchronous MongoDB & Pydantic.
Vellum is a type-safe, async Python ODM for MongoDB built on Pydantic v2 and Motor. It provides a clean repository pattern, fluent aggregation builder, lifecycle hooks, optimistic concurrency, soft deletes, and transactions — all with full type hints.
Features
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Type-safe queries | Expression classes for all MongoDB operators (Eq, Gt, In, Regex, ElemMatch, Text Search, Geospatial, ...) |
| Fluent field references | Write Product.price < 10 or Product.fields.price < 10 |
| Fluent aggregation | AggregationPipeline with match, group, project, sort, unwind, lookup, add_fields, count |
| Lifecycle hooks | before_insert, after_insert, before_update, ... on your model |
| Optimistic concurrency | OptimisticConcurrencyMixin — automatic version-based conflict detection |
| Soft delete | SoftDeleteMixin — automatic filtering, soft_delete() / restore() |
| Transactions | async with repo.transaction() as session: |
| FastAPI integration | repository_factory for Depends injection |
| Aggregation output models | Validate aggregation results with Pydantic models |
| Migrations | MigrationRunner with up/down, status, rollback |
| Caching | CachedRepository with configurable TTL and invalidation |
| Encryption | EncryptedField / encrypted_field — Fernet-based field encryption |
| Schema Doctor | SchemaDoctor — check and repair schema conformance |
| Seeding | Seeder / Factory — generate test data |
| Change streams | ChangeStream — watch MongoDB change events |
| Telemetry | TracedRepository — wrap repository with tracing |
Quick Start
import asyncio
from motor.motor_asyncio import AsyncIOMotorClient
from vellum import VellumBaseModel, VellumRepository
# 1. Define a model
class Product(VellumBaseModel):
name: str
price: float
class Settings:
collection_name = "products"
async def main():
# 2. Connect
client = AsyncIOMotorClient("mongodb://localhost:27017")
db = client["myapp"]
repo = VellumRepository(Product, db)
# 3. Create
product = Product(name="Widget", price=9.99)
created = await repo.create(product)
print(f"Created: {created.id}")
# 4. Read
fetched = await repo.get(created.id)
print(f"Fetched: {fetched.name}")
# 5. Update
fetched.price = 24.99
updated = await repo.update(fetched.id, fetched)
# 6. Query with field references
results = await repo.find(
(Product.price >= 10.0).to_mongo_query()
)
# 7. Delete
await repo.delete(created.id)
client.close()
asyncio.run(main())
